Making someone pay for a prize...

Theres a bit of an argument brewing at work. One of the staff one a weekend away at a company draw a few months back and it was booked for the weekend after next. He can't now go due to another commitment, however he is selling the weekend for £500, which is probably a bit less than its worth. The argument is that since he didn't pay for it, and its a company prize he should just give it to the 2nd placed person, or hold another raffle, while his argument is that he was the lucky winner, so there he should be free to do with it as he sees fit and why should he pass on his turn of fortune?

Who's right? The winner or the objectors?
